K.M. v. Superior Court CA5
Petitioner K.M. (mother) seeks an extraordinary writ from the juvenile court’s orders issued at a six-month review hearing (Welf. & Inst. Code, § 366.21, subd. (e)(1)) terminating her reunification services and setting a section 366.26 hearing as to her now two-year-old son, Evan. She alleges error on the following grounds: (1) the court erred in finding she was provided reasonable reunification services; (2) the court applied the wrong standard in assessing the probability of return; and (3) the court was unaware it had discretion to continue services to the 12-month review hearing. We deny the petition.
